REMX (VanEck Rare Earth and Strategic Metals ETF) trades at $69.85, down 3.88% over the past day amid a bearish technical signal, with moving averages indicating strong selling pressure. The ETF provides exposure to 38 global rare earth and strategic metals companies, heavily weighted toward China, and exhibits high volatility around 50% annually. Recent news highlights rare earth metals' strategic importance in technology and energy security, with China's export controls and geopolitical tensions influencing supply dynamics.

Outlook remains speculative due to geopolitical risks and commodity price swings, offering growth potential from the reshoring of critical mineral supply chains. Key risks include China concentration, regulatory changes, and high ETF turnover, making it suitable only for aggressive portfolios as a satellite holding. Investors should weigh supply chain diversification trends against volatility and liquidity concerns.

About Kaltura Inc

Kaltura Inc provides live and on-demand video SaaS solutions to thousands of organizations around the world, engaging hundreds of millions of viewers at home, at work, and school. It also offers specialized industry solutions, including Learning Management System Video, Lecture Capture, and Virtual Classroom for educational institutions, as well as a TV Solution for media and telecom companies. About VanEck Rare Earth/Strategic Metals

REMX invests in global companies involved in producing, refining, and recycling rare earth and strategic metals. It provides targeted exposure to critical minerals used in high-tech and green energy, with top holdings like Albemarle and Pilbara Minerals.
